Child Nutrition Program

The Zachary Community School Board Child Nutrition Program goal is to server healthy, nutritious choices that are appetizing, affordable and available to all students. Menus, which are consistent with the Recommended Dietary Allowances (RDAs), the calorie goals, and the Dietary Guidelines for Americans, have been planned so that customers can have healthier lives….now and in the years to come. Method of Payment: On-line Credit Card Payment through schoolpassport.com. It’s a simple, secure and convenient way to view account balances, and pay for school meals.  Transactions placed prior to midnight central standard time on schoolpassport.com are credited to your child’s account the next business day.

Method of Payment: On-line credit card, cash or check (Checks will be accepted through May 1, 2009.)

Make check payable to: Zachary Community School Board Child Nutrition Program

Write one check per child: In the memo section of the check, write the student’s name and point of service LUNCH NUMBER, if known.

Meal Payments: Prepayment for meals by the month, week or year is recommended. Students spend less time in line if meals are prepaid. You can maximize the time your child has to eat lunch by taking care of meal payments at the beginning of the month or week rather than in the lunch line.  If you pay for meals, it is recommended that you send August’s payment on the first day of school.

Parents of Elementary students: Place cash payments in a sealed envelope that is labeled with the student’s name, purpose for which money is intended, and amount of cash or check sent.

Free/Reduced Price Meal Application: An application for school meal benefits will be sent home to parents.  Parents are to fill out ONE APPLICATION PER FAMILY. The completed application form may be returned to the Zachary Community School Board Office, 4656 Main Street, Zachary, LA 70805. or submit the application to the cafeteria manager at the school where your youngest child is enrolled. Those students who received free or reduced price benefits last year will begin the new school year on the same status. However, by September 19, 2008 a new application must be submitted and processed for the 2008-2009 school year in order for meal benefits to continue.
